LC1D25F7 Product Details
- Product Certifications UL BV RINA CCC GL GOST DNV LROS (Lloyds register of shipping) CSA
- Standards CSA C22.2 No 14 EN 60947-4-1 EN 60947-5-1 IEC 60947-4-1 IEC 60947-5-1 UL 508

- Associated Fuse Rating 10 A gG signalling circuit IEC 60947-5-1 63 A gG <= 690 V type 1 power circuit 40 A gG <= 690 V type 2 power circuit
- Irms Rated Making Capacity 140 A AC signalling circuit IEC 60947-5-1 250 A DC signalling circuit IEC 60947-5-1 450 A 440 V power circuit IEC 60947
- Utilisation Category AC-3 AC-4 AC-1
- Safety Reliability Level B10d = 1369863 cycles contactor with nominal load EN/ISO 13849-1 B10d = 20000000 cycles contactor with mechanical load EN/ISO 13849-1
- Power Dissipation Per Pole 3.2 W AC-1 1.25 W AC-3
- Auxiliary Contacts Type Mechanically linked 1 NO + 1 NC IEC 60947-5-1 Mirror contact 1 NC IEC 60947-4-1
- Hold-In Power Consumption In VA 7.5 VA 60 Hz 0.3 68 °F (20 °C)) 7 VA 50 Hz 0.3 68 °F (20 °C))
- Mounting Support Plate Rail
- Operating Time 12...22 ms closing 4...19 ms opening
- [Ie] Rated Operational Current 25 A 140 °F (60 °C)) <= 440 V AC AC-3 power circuit 40 A 140 °F (60 °C)) <= 440 V AC AC-1 power circuit
- [Ue] Rated Operational Voltage Power circuit <= 690 V AC 25...400 Hz Power circuit <= 300 V DC
- Inrush Power In VA 70 VA 60 Hz 0.75 68 °F (20 °C)) 70 VA 50 Hz 0.75 68 °F (20 °C))
- Non-Overlap Time 1.5 ms on de-energisation between NC and NO contact 1.5 ms on energisation between NC and NO contact
- Electrical Durability 1.65 Mcycles 25 A AC-3 <= 440 V 1.4 Mcycles 40 A AC-1 <= 440 V
- Contactor Application Resistive load Motor control
- [Ith] Conventional Free Air Thermal Current 10 A 140 °F (60 °C) signalling circuit 40 A 140 °F (60 °C) power circuit
- Insulation Resistance > 10 MOhm signalling circuit
- Coil Technology Without built-in suppressor module
- Minimum Switching Voltage 17 V signalling circuit
- Minimum Switching Current 5 mA signalling circuit
- Heat Dissipation 2…3 W 50/60 Hz
- Signalling Circuit Frequency 25...400 Hz
- Mechanical Durability 15 Mcycles
- Maximum Operating Rate 3600 cyc/h 140 °F (60 °C)
- Front Cover With
- Average Impedance 2 mOhm - Ith 40 A 50 Hz power circuit
- Overvoltage Category III
- [Uimp] Rated Impulse Withstand Voltage 6 kV IEC 60947
- Control Circuit Type AC 50/60 Hz
- Rated Breaking Capacity 450 A 440 V power circuit IEC 60947
- Auxiliary Contact Composition 1 NO + 1 NC
- [Uc] Control Circuit Voltage 110 V AC 50/60 Hz
- Product Or Component Type Contactor
- Device Short Name LC1D
- Poles Description 3P
- Power Pole Contact Composition 3 NO
- Product Name TeSys D
- Range TeSys
